LaBrujita 29-01-2002, 02:31:PM oops, interesting fact:
At the age of 10, playing for Balkan's 12-year olds in a game against Vellinge, Zlatan was put on the bench for the first half. Balkan was down 4-0. In the second half, Zlatan came in and scored 8 goals and Balkan won 8-5. Vellinge protested because they where convinced Zlatan was older than 12, when he in fact was two years younger than the rest of the players. Balkan even had to show up Zlatan's birth certificate to convince them of his age.
